Gill, Tillis, Emery Inducted Into Country Music Hall Of Fame
NASHVILLE, Tenn. (AP) - Country star
Vince Gill, singer and humorist
Mel Tillis and television and radio personality
Ralph Emery were inducted into the Country Music Hall of Fame on Sunday.
Al Anderson,
Guy Clark,
Rodney Crowell,
Emmylou Harris and
Michael McDonald saluted Gill, while
Bobby Bare,
Dierks Bentley,
Kenny Rogers and
Pam Tillis paid tribute to Tillis. Artists honoring Emery included
Con Hunley,
Raul Malo and
Ray Stevens.
